    I've got a question for the guru's on this thread -- albeit my application is 2nd Gen :alien:

    I've got the OBDLink app on my android interfacing with an OBD MX+ scantool, and I've got a PID for Engine Oil Temp under the Toyota Enahnced Diagnostic. I get oil-temp readings that seem to be within the right range..a little higher than coolant temp but not as high as, say, an Oxygen Sensor. However, everything I've found online says there is no oil-temp sensor on this 2TR-FE engine.

    Is there any way to find out where a PID is recieving it's information?
